From cceb9b5e85926881c01f94d8777ed50a142cc1e7 Mon Sep 17 00:00:00 2001 From: Daniel Maizel Date: Thu, 13 Nov 2025 12:38:30 +0200 Subject: [PATCH 1/7] chore: disable Argo Rollouts by default and add deprecation notice in values.yaml --- charts/gitops-runtime/values.yaml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/charts/gitops-runtime/values.yaml b/charts/gitops-runtime/values.yaml index 5b0549fb..79120239 100644 --- a/charts/gitops-runtime/values.yaml +++ b/charts/gitops-runtime/values.yaml @@ -344,8 +344,10 @@ codefreshWorkflowLogStoreCM: #----------------------------------------------------------------------------------------------------------------------- # Argo rollouts #----------------------------------------------------------------------------------------------------------------------- +# -- Argo Rollouts is deprecated and disabled by default. It will be completely removed in February 2026. +# If you require Argo Rollouts, you can manually override this value to true in your Helm values files. argo-rollouts: - enabled: true + enabled: false fullnameOverride: argo-rollouts controller: replicas: 1 From aac4803641df7173693a4f5b19d65022bb225273 Mon Sep 17 00:00:00 2001 From: Daniel Maizel Date: Thu, 13 Nov 2025 12:40:06 +0200 Subject: [PATCH 2/7] feat: enable single namespace restriction for Argo Workflows in values.yaml --- charts/gitops-runtime/values.yaml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/charts/gitops-runtime/values.yaml b/charts/gitops-runtime/values.yaml index 79120239..6c9e2dd1 100644 --- a/charts/gitops-runtime/values.yaml +++ b/charts/gitops-runtime/values.yaml @@ -317,6 +317,9 @@ argo-events: argo-workflows: fullnameOverride: argo enabled: true + # -- Restrict Argo Workflows to operate only in a single namespace (the namespace of the Helm release). + # This ensures it does not interfere with any other instances of Argo Workflows installed on your cluster. + singleNamespace: true server: # -- auth-mode needs to be set to client to be able to see workflow logs from Codefresh UI authModes: From b905c30f276ce4ca6694694c72380e9be4265c34 Mon Sep 17 00:00:00 2001 From: Daniel Maizel Date: Thu, 13 Nov 2025 14:38:20 +0200 Subject: [PATCH 3/7] fix tests --- .../gitops-runtime/tests/values/global-constraints-values.yaml | 3 +++ .../tests/values/subcharts-constraints-values.yaml | 1 + 2 files changed, 4 insertions(+) diff --git a/charts/gitops-runtime/tests/values/global-constraints-values.yaml b/charts/gitops-runtime/tests/values/global-constraints-values.yaml index 573c2e46..10762b78 100644 --- a/charts/gitops-runtime/tests/values/global-constraints-values.yaml +++ b/charts/gitops-runtime/tests/values/global-constraints-values.yaml @@ -7,3 +7,6 @@ global: operator: Equal value: some-value effect: NoSchedule + +argo-rollouts: + enabled: true diff --git a/charts/gitops-runtime/tests/values/subcharts-constraints-values.yaml b/charts/gitops-runtime/tests/values/subcharts-constraints-values.yaml index 766d781c..66a438c4 100644 --- a/charts/gitops-runtime/tests/values/subcharts-constraints-values.yaml +++ b/charts/gitops-runtime/tests/values/subcharts-constraints-values.yaml @@ -69,6 +69,7 @@ argo-events: tolerations: *tolerations argo-rollouts: + enabled: true controller: nodeSelector: *nodeSelector tolerations: *tolerations From eb019f858f9e2833061b2264d4448cb16147fadd Mon Sep 17 00:00:00 2001 From: Mikhail Klimko Date: Thu, 13 Nov 2025 17:02:05 +0300 Subject: [PATCH 4/7] empty From 873ac0a07f33adca68db03d6fbda60b19cdf080a Mon Sep 17 00:00:00 2001 From: cf-ci-bot-v2 Date: Thu, 13 Nov 2025 14:04:46 +0000 Subject: [PATCH 5/7] CI Automatic commit - align Chart version --- charts/gitops-runtime/Chart.yaml | 56 ++++++++++++++++---------------- 1 file changed, 28 insertions(+), 28 deletions(-) diff --git a/charts/gitops-runtime/Chart.yaml b/charts/gitops-runtime/Chart.yaml index b86d82d7..1e3f1a86 100644 --- a/charts/gitops-runtime/Chart.yaml +++ b/charts/gitops-runtime/Chart.yaml @@ -14,31 +14,31 @@ maintainers: annotations: artifacthub.io/alternativeName: "codefresh-gitops-runtime" dependencies: -- name: argo-cd - repository: https://argoproj.github.io/argo-helm - condition: argo-cd.enabled - version: 9.0.2 -- name: argo-events - repository: https://codefresh-io.github.io/argo-helm - version: 2.4.9-cap-CR-30841 - condition: argo-events.enabled -- name: argo-workflows - repository: https://codefresh-io.github.io/argo-helm - version: 0.45.16-v3.6.7-cap-CR-30835 - condition: argo-workflows.enabled -- name: argo-rollouts - repository: https://codefresh-io.github.io/argo-helm - version: 2.37.3-7-v1.7.2-cap-OSS-697 - condition: argo-rollouts.enabled -- name: sealed-secrets - repository: https://bitnami-labs.github.io/sealed-secrets/ - version: 2.17.2 -- name: codefresh-tunnel-client - repository: oci://quay.io/codefresh/charts - version: 0.1.22 - alias: tunnel-client - condition: tunnel-client.enabled -- name: redis-ha - version: 4.33.4 - repository: https://dandydeveloper.github.io/charts/ - condition: redis-ha.enabled + - name: argo-cd + repository: https://argoproj.github.io/argo-helm + condition: argo-cd.enabled + version: 9.0.2 + - name: argo-events + repository: https://codefresh-io.github.io/argo-helm + version: 2.4.9-cap-CR-30841 + condition: argo-events.enabled + - name: argo-workflows + repository: https://codefresh-io.github.io/argo-helm + version: 0.45.16-v3.6.7-cap-CR-30835 + condition: argo-workflows.enabled + - name: argo-rollouts + repository: https://codefresh-io.github.io/argo-helm + version: 2.37.3-7-v1.7.2-cap-OSS-697 + condition: argo-rollouts.enabled + - name: sealed-secrets + repository: https://bitnami-labs.github.io/sealed-secrets/ + version: 2.17.2 + - name: codefresh-tunnel-client + repository: oci://quay.io/codefresh/charts + version: 0.1.22 + alias: tunnel-client + condition: tunnel-client.enabled + - name: redis-ha + version: 4.33.4 + repository: https://dandydeveloper.github.io/charts/ + condition: redis-ha.enabled From 5b5fb1cb3ed5052ba448ab8e4ae78f32afd86614 Mon Sep 17 00:00:00 2001 From: Daniel Maizel Date: Thu, 13 Nov 2025 18:38:25 +0200 Subject: [PATCH 6/7] Revert "CI Automatic commit - align Chart version" This reverts commit c28f424c829e47fc240bf71777ddc54d79ce35c4. --- charts/gitops-runtime/Chart.yaml | 58 ++++++++++++++++---------------- 1 file changed, 29 insertions(+), 29 deletions(-) diff --git a/charts/gitops-runtime/Chart.yaml b/charts/gitops-runtime/Chart.yaml index 1e3f1a86..b4fc7f3c 100644 --- a/charts/gitops-runtime/Chart.yaml +++ b/charts/gitops-runtime/Chart.yaml @@ -2,7 +2,7 @@ apiVersion: v2 appVersion: 1.0.0-rc.1 description: A Helm chart for Codefresh gitops runtime name: gitops-runtime -version: 25.11-0 +version: 0.0.0 home: https://github.com/codefresh-io/gitops-runtime-helm icon: https://avatars1.githubusercontent.com/u/11412079?v=3 keywords: @@ -14,31 +14,31 @@ maintainers: annotations: artifacthub.io/alternativeName: "codefresh-gitops-runtime" dependencies: - - name: argo-cd - repository: https://argoproj.github.io/argo-helm - condition: argo-cd.enabled - version: 9.0.2 - - name: argo-events - repository: https://codefresh-io.github.io/argo-helm - version: 2.4.9-cap-CR-30841 - condition: argo-events.enabled - - name: argo-workflows - repository: https://codefresh-io.github.io/argo-helm - version: 0.45.16-v3.6.7-cap-CR-30835 - condition: argo-workflows.enabled - - name: argo-rollouts - repository: https://codefresh-io.github.io/argo-helm - version: 2.37.3-7-v1.7.2-cap-OSS-697 - condition: argo-rollouts.enabled - - name: sealed-secrets - repository: https://bitnami-labs.github.io/sealed-secrets/ - version: 2.17.2 - - name: codefresh-tunnel-client - repository: oci://quay.io/codefresh/charts - version: 0.1.22 - alias: tunnel-client - condition: tunnel-client.enabled - - name: redis-ha - version: 4.33.4 - repository: https://dandydeveloper.github.io/charts/ - condition: redis-ha.enabled +- name: argo-cd + repository: https://argoproj.github.io/argo-helm + condition: argo-cd.enabled + version: 9.0.2 +- name: argo-events + repository: https://codefresh-io.github.io/argo-helm + version: 2.4.9-cap-CR-30841 + condition: argo-events.enabled +- name: argo-workflows + repository: https://codefresh-io.github.io/argo-helm + version: 0.45.16-v3.6.7-cap-CR-30835 + condition: argo-workflows.enabled +- name: argo-rollouts + repository: https://codefresh-io.github.io/argo-helm + version: 2.37.3-7-v1.7.2-cap-OSS-697 + condition: argo-rollouts.enabled +- name: sealed-secrets + repository: https://bitnami-labs.github.io/sealed-secrets/ + version: 2.17.2 +- name: codefresh-tunnel-client + repository: oci://quay.io/codefresh/charts + version: 0.1.22 + alias: tunnel-client + condition: tunnel-client.enabled +- name: redis-ha + version: 4.33.4 + repository: https://dandydeveloper.github.io/charts/ + condition: redis-ha.enabled From 8261a942e6cffa73b9ab8fdd4098dc816b50f2e6 Mon Sep 17 00:00:00 2001 From: cf-ci-bot-v2 Date: Thu, 13 Nov 2025 16:41:56 +0000 Subject: [PATCH 7/7] CI Automatic commit - align Chart version --- charts/gitops-runtime/Chart.yaml | 58 ++++++++++++++++---------------- 1 file changed, 29 insertions(+), 29 deletions(-) diff --git a/charts/gitops-runtime/Chart.yaml b/charts/gitops-runtime/Chart.yaml index b4fc7f3c..1e3f1a86 100644 --- a/charts/gitops-runtime/Chart.yaml +++ b/charts/gitops-runtime/Chart.yaml @@ -2,7 +2,7 @@ apiVersion: v2 appVersion: 1.0.0-rc.1 description: A Helm chart for Codefresh gitops runtime name: gitops-runtime -version: 0.0.0 +version: 25.11-0 home: https://github.com/codefresh-io/gitops-runtime-helm icon: https://avatars1.githubusercontent.com/u/11412079?v=3 keywords: @@ -14,31 +14,31 @@ maintainers: annotations: artifacthub.io/alternativeName: "codefresh-gitops-runtime" dependencies: -- name: argo-cd - repository: https://argoproj.github.io/argo-helm - condition: argo-cd.enabled - version: 9.0.2 -- name: argo-events - repository: https://codefresh-io.github.io/argo-helm - version: 2.4.9-cap-CR-30841 - condition: argo-events.enabled -- name: argo-workflows - repository: https://codefresh-io.github.io/argo-helm - version: 0.45.16-v3.6.7-cap-CR-30835 - condition: argo-workflows.enabled -- name: argo-rollouts - repository: https://codefresh-io.github.io/argo-helm - version: 2.37.3-7-v1.7.2-cap-OSS-697 - condition: argo-rollouts.enabled -- name: sealed-secrets - repository: https://bitnami-labs.github.io/sealed-secrets/ - version: 2.17.2 -- name: codefresh-tunnel-client - repository: oci://quay.io/codefresh/charts - version: 0.1.22 - alias: tunnel-client - condition: tunnel-client.enabled -- name: redis-ha - version: 4.33.4 - repository: https://dandydeveloper.github.io/charts/ - condition: redis-ha.enabled + - name: argo-cd + repository: https://argoproj.github.io/argo-helm + condition: argo-cd.enabled + version: 9.0.2 + - name: argo-events + repository: https://codefresh-io.github.io/argo-helm + version: 2.4.9-cap-CR-30841 + condition: argo-events.enabled + - name: argo-workflows + repository: https://codefresh-io.github.io/argo-helm + version: 0.45.16-v3.6.7-cap-CR-30835 + condition: argo-workflows.enabled + - name: argo-rollouts + repository: https://codefresh-io.github.io/argo-helm + version: 2.37.3-7-v1.7.2-cap-OSS-697 + condition: argo-rollouts.enabled + - name: sealed-secrets + repository: https://bitnami-labs.github.io/sealed-secrets/ + version: 2.17.2 + - name: codefresh-tunnel-client + repository: oci://quay.io/codefresh/charts + version: 0.1.22 + alias: tunnel-client + condition: tunnel-client.enabled + - name: redis-ha + version: 4.33.4 + repository: https://dandydeveloper.github.io/charts/ + condition: redis-ha.enabled